Leak Repair

A dripping faucet is more than annoying...it is expensive. Even small leaks can waste significant amounts of water. Hot water leaks are a waste of water and of the energy used to heat the water.

Leaks inside the toilet can waste up to 200 gallons of water a day. Toilet leaks can be detected by adding a few drops of food coloring to water in the toilet tank and wait approximately 5 minutes without flushing. If the colored water appears in the bowl without flushing, the toilet is leaking. If you have a leaking faucet or toilet, stop pouring money down the drain and repair it by replacing worn washers or other leaking components.

Leak detection dye tablets are available at the Easton Suburban Water Authority office.
